Posted on: 24/07/2025
Responsibilities :
- Design and build scalable microservices in Go to power our SDKs, ad delivery, and analytics platform.
- Architect and maintain high-throughput, low-latency microservices and data pipelines for real-time processing.
- Drive end-to-end feature development in collaboration with Mobile, Analytics, and Data teams.
- Continuously optimize for performance, reliability, and cost-efficiency across services and infrastructure.
- Influence architecture and technical direction, ensuring systems are scalable, maintainable, and future-ready.
Requirements :
- 2-5 years of production experience with Go (Golang), with a strong grasp of its concurrency modelgoroutines, channels, and mutexes.
- Proven expertise in building scalable microservices, RESTful APIs, and distributed backend systems.
- Hands-on experience with Kubernetes(K8s), Docker, CI/CD pipelines, and cloud platforms such as GCP or AWS.
- Proficient in SQL/NoSQL databases like PostgreSQL, MongoDB, and BigQuery, with caching tools such as Redis to enhance performance.
- Experience with monitoring and observability tools such as Prometheus and Grafana.
- Experience with code profiling and performance tuning using tools like pprof.
Bonus Points :
- Experience with event-driven architectures (Kafka, RabbitMQ).
- Prior work in product-focused or startup environments.
Did you find something suspicious?
Posted By
Posted in
Backend Development
Functional Area
Backend Development
Job Code
1517694
Interview Questions for you
View All